CSS Font Smoothing Generator - Anti-aliasing
In the world of web design and development, delivering crisp, clear, and readable text is paramount. The way fonts render across different browsers and operating systems can vary widely, impacting user experience and overall site professionalism. This is where the CSS Font Smoothing Generator comes into play—a powerful tool designed to enhance text clarity through advanced anti-aliasing and font smoothing techniques.
What is CSS Font Smoothing?
Font smoothing is a technique used to improve the appearance of text on digital screens by reducing the jagged edges of characters, making them appear smoother and easier on the eyes. It primarily relies on anti-aliasing and subpixel rendering to enhance text sharpness, font clarity, and overall rendering quality.
Key Features of the CSS Font Smoothing Generator
- Cross-browser and cross-platform support: Generates CSS properties compatible with WebKit (Safari, Chrome), Firefox, and legacy browsers.
- Customizable smoothing options: Allows fine-tuning of font smoothing intensity depending on design needs.
- Easy CSS output: Provides ready-to-use CSS snippets that can be directly applied to your stylesheets.
- Anti-aliasing enhancement: Creates smoother edges for readable, crisp text across all display types.
- User-friendly interface: Simple controls designed for developers of all skill levels.
Benefits of Using the CSS Font Smoothing Generator
- Improves text rendering by enhancing anti-aliasing and subpixel rendering techniques.
- Enhances website readability and user experience by optimizing font sharpness.
- Ensures consistent font clarity across various operating systems such as macOS, Windows, and Linux.
- Supports better display font performance on high-resolution and standard screens alike.
- Reduces eye strain for users by making text easier to read on digital devices.
Practical Use Cases for the Tool
- Web developers looking to enhance the typography quality on websites and web apps.
- UI/UX designers aiming for pixel-perfect text rendering in interfaces.
- Digital publishers and bloggers seeking crisper and cleaner font display for articles and content.
- Software engineers working on cross-platform projects who need consistent font appearance.
- Anyone interested in font anti-aliasing optimization to improve end-user reading experience.
Step-by-Step Guide to Using the CSS Font Smoothing Generator
- Navigate to the CSS Font Smoothing Generator tool.
- Choose the font smoothing type: options typically include
-webkit-font-smoothingfor WebKit browsers andfont-smoothfor Firefox and other platforms. - Select the anti-aliasing level: options like
auto,antialiased, orsubpixel-antialiased. - Preview the text rendering: many tools feature a live preview to see how the settings affect font clarity and sharpness.
- Copy the generated CSS code: the tool outputs cross-browser compatible CSS which you can then paste into your stylesheet.
- Apply the CSS to your desired element(s):strong> for example:
body {
-webkit-font-smoothing: antialiased;
-moz-osx-font-smoothing: grayscale;
}
Pro Tips for Optimal Font Smoothing
- Test across browsers and devices: Font smoothing behaves differently depending on OS and browser, so always preview on multiple platforms.
- Use in conjunction with appropriate fonts: Some fonts naturally respond better to smoothing properties.
- Don’t overuse high-intensity smoothing: Excessive anti-aliasing might make fonts look blurry rather than crisp.
- Combine with proper font-weight and size: Lighter fonts at smaller sizes benefit most from smoothing tools.
- Keep accessibility in mind: Always balance smoothness with readability to ensure accessibility compliance.
Frequently Asked Questions (FAQs)
What is the difference between -webkit-font-smoothing and font-smooth?
-webkit-font-smoothing is a non-standard CSS property primarily supported in WebKit-based browsers like Safari and Chrome to control font antialiasing. font-smooth is an unofficial property used in some browsers like Firefox for similar purposes, though its support varies.
Does font smoothing impact performance?
Font smoothing has minimal impact on performance since it only affects rendering quality rather than resource-intensive processes.
Can I use font smoothing for all fonts?
Most display fonts and system fonts can benefit from font smoothing, but results vary depending on font design and size.
Is font smoothing necessary for modern displays?
Yes. Even with high-DPI and retina displays, font smoothing enhances text clarity by adjusting anti-aliasing to device capabilities.
How do I disable font smoothing if needed?
Setting the font smoothing property to none or not applying any smoothing will render fonts in their default form, which may appear more jagged.
Conclusion
The CSS Font Smoothing Generator is an indispensable utility for front-end developers and designers committed to delivering sharp, readable, and aesthetically pleasing typography. By harnessing the power of anti-aliasing and subpixel font rendering, this tool improves text rendering quality across platforms and browsers with minimal effort.
Whether you're polishing a blog, fine-tuning a web app, or ensuring consistent font clarity on all devices, this generator helps you achieve radiant font sharpness and text crispness—elevating the user experience to the next level.